Cauliflower Enchilada Bake

Ingredients:
2 cups cauliflower florets
1/2 cup black beans
1/4 cup organic corn
1 stalk green onions
1/2 cup chopped bell peppers
3 tbsp chopped cilantro
1/2 tbsp cumin
1/2 tbsp chili powder
1 clove garlic minced
1/2 cup enchilada sauce
Mozzarella (Rumiano is my favorite)
Instructions:
Roast cauliflower florets 30 min on 375 degrees.
Combine cauliflower, beans, corn, peppers, spices, green onions and enchilada sauce.
Top with mozzarella.
Place in a glass baking dish and bake on 350 degrees for about 20 min. OR until cheese bubbles.
